Output de384661f15a230098fb8eb071ccf627f952f39e320ddf2c308336d5cff6d6e4:12

value
1009075
script pubkey
OP_0 OP_PUSHBYTES_20 6e5de323f2cd35275b43c9a94284aa851684c310
address
bc1qdew7xglje56jwk6rex559p92s5tgfscs4xzj9a
transaction
de384661f15a230098fb8eb071ccf627f952f39e320ddf2c308336d5cff6d6e4
spent
true